## Property Overview

Welcome to Residence 10AB at 230 East 50th Street, a fully reimagined prewar home, thoughtfully renovated from top to bottom. This sprawling four bedroom residence plus a home office offers exceptional scale and a layout well suited for both everyday living and entertaining.

Arrive through a 1920s wood-clad elevator to a private landing and vestibule anchored by a large walk-in closet. A palette of newly installed European White Oak flooring introduces the home’s refined and thoughtfully curated aesthetic, while newly added central air conditioning ensures year-round comfort. The expansive, sun-splashed great room unfolds beyond, featuring a chef’s kitchen anchored by an oversized island clad in Aurea Siegfried stone, complemented by Thermador professional appliances, including a gas cooktop, oven, two dishwashers, fully paneled refrigerator, pop-up hood, and a dedicated Thermador wine fridge.

The adjoining dining area is centered around a dramatic Marine Black marble wood-burning fireplace, one of two in the residence, creating a warm and sculptural backdrop for gatherings. Additionally, the residence features gorgeous brand-new steel casement windows, Lutron smart home lighting, and is wired for Sonos throughout.

A separate living room offers the home’s second Marine Black marble wood-burning fireplace. For entertaining, the room features a custom wet bar, complete with a U-Line beverage refrigerator and under-counter ice maker. A beautifully appointed powder room, wrapped in custom wallcovering and Gold Glass Penny Round Mosaic Tile, completes this wing.

The home’s intelligently crafted layout features four well-proportioned bedrooms, each enhanced with refined finishes, custom millwork, and thoughtfully selected designer lighting. A dedicated home office/den with a stunning mullioned glass partition wall adds flexibility for work or guest accommodations.

The serene primary suite includes space for a king-sized layout, fully outfitted custom closet, and an en-suite bath finished with an Aberdeen oak vanity topped with Carrara marble, textured wallcovering, and Juniper Polished Porcelain Tile complemented by polished gold fixtures. Additional bedrooms feature bespoke details such as custom built-ins and elevated, thoughtfully selected wallcoverings.

Located in an established prewar, white-glove cooperative, 230 East 50th Street offers impeccable service, a stunning English courtyard garden, a lush furnished roof deck with panoramic city views, a live-in resident manager, 24-hour doorman and hand-delivered mail and packages. A private storage unit transfers with the home.

With every room elevated through curated materials and high-end craftsmanship, Residence 10AB is a newly completed turnkey masterpiece, offering the rare opportunity to move into a genuinely one-of-a-kind home in the heart of Midtown East.

## Sales Evidence

### How this price compares

The median closed price for comparable co-op four-bedroom sales in Midtown East is $4,022,500, based on 4 sales between October 2024 and March 2025. This home is asking $3,250,000, $772,500 below that median. The middle half of those sales closed between $3,646,250 and $4,312,500.

- **Median closed price**: $4,022,500
- **Middle half**: $3,646,250 – $4,312,500
- **Based on**: 4 co-op four-bedroom sales in Midtown East
- **Period**: October 2024 – March 2025

Square footage is recorded for only 0 of these 4 sales (0%), so no price per square foot is shown for this group. Co-op sales rarely carry a floor area, and a figure drawn from a handful of them would not describe the rest.

Across the 4 of these sales with a published asking price, the median closed at 81% of what it originally asked. 100% of them closed below the original ask.

This building has not had enough comparable sales of its own in the period to support a median, so the benchmark is drawn from Midtown East instead.

### How these sales were negotiated

- **Sold vs original ask**: 81% of the original ask
- **Closed below ask**: 100% of 4 sales
- **Listed → in contract**: 188 days (about 27 weeks)
- **In contract → closed**: 94 days (about 13 weeks)

Across the 4 of these sales with a published asking price, the median closed at 81% of what it originally asked. 100% of them closed below the original ask.

Half of these homes were in contract within 188 days (about 27 weeks) of coming to market, based on the 3 with a recorded listing date.

Once a deal was agreed, closing took a further 94 days (about 13 weeks), based on the 4 with both dates recorded. A co-op board package and its interview account for much of that.

These are two separate periods measured on different clocks — time to find a buyer, and time from agreed deal to closing. They are medians of different sets of sales and do not add together into a single "days on market" figure.

Based on 4 co-op four-bedroom sales in Midtown East, October 2024 – March 2025. Each figure counts only the sales that recorded the dates it needs, which is why the denominators differ.

Sale prices are the consideration recorded with the City in ACRIS, and each sale is dated by the day the City recorded it. A closing date reported to the MLS typically falls one to two weeks earlier. Recorded sales describe what has already happened and are not an appraisal, a valuation, or an estimate of what this home will sell for.
